What companies run services between Coquitlam, BC, Canada and Commercial - Broadway Station, BC, Canada?

TransLink CA operates a subway from Lafarge Lake-Douglas Station @ Platform 1 to Commercial-Broadway Station @ Platform 1 every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$4–7 and the journey takes 34 min. Alternatively, TransLink CA operates a bus from Lafarge Lake-Douglas Station @ Bay 3 to Commercial-Broadway Station @ Bay 4 every 3 hours. Tickets cost $4–7 and the journey takes 42 min.
